Output 0d101a4cb80faa089ab89d0127cc1394a94cb01dc2d311126c7893e3b57b4fe7:0

value
573334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0256ff73dec581729163e67c49ea2147e53b92a OP_EQUAL
address
3LfbKdyVEm4Vqfd1PmxqHtX13J6eSBKH19
transaction
0d101a4cb80faa089ab89d0127cc1394a94cb01dc2d311126c7893e3b57b4fe7
spent
true